Fix pdfobject require

This commit is contained in:
Yukai Huang 2016-10-09 10:51:39 +08:00
parent 67d118782d
commit 196d546f7e
2 changed files with 19 additions and 15 deletions

View file

@ -1,3 +1,6 @@
var hljs = require('highlight.js');
var PDFObject = require('pdfobject');
//auto update last change //auto update last change
var createtime = null; var createtime = null;
var lastchangetime = null; var lastchangetime = null;

View file

@ -51,7 +51,6 @@ require('js-sequence-diagrams');
require('flowchart.js'); require('flowchart.js');
require('viz.js'); require('viz.js');
require('pdfobject');
require('file-saver'); require('file-saver');
require('store'); require('store');
require('js-url'); require('js-url');
@ -414,18 +413,18 @@ var statusType = {
var defaultMode = modeType.view; var defaultMode = modeType.view;
//global vars //global vars
var loaded = false; window.loaded = false;
var needRefresh = false; window.needRefresh = false;
var isDirty = false; window.isDirty = false;
var editShown = false; window.editShown = false;
var visibleXS = false; window.visibleXS = false;
var visibleSM = false; window.visibleSM = false;
var visibleMD = false; window.visibleMD = false;
var visibleLG = false; window.visibleLG = false;
var isTouchDevice = 'ontouchstart' in document.documentElement; window.isTouchDevice = 'ontouchstart' in document.documentElement;
window.currentMode = defaultMode; window.currentMode = defaultMode;
var currentStatus = statusType.offline; window.currentStatus = statusType.offline;
var lastInfo = { window.lastInfo = {
needRestore: false, needRestore: false,
cursor: null, cursor: null,
scroll: null, scroll: null,
@ -447,9 +446,9 @@ var lastInfo = {
}, },
history: null history: null
}; };
var personalInfo = {}; window.personalInfo = {};
var onlineUsers = []; window.onlineUsers = [];
var fileTypes = { window.fileTypes = {
"pl": "perl", "pl": "perl",
"cgi": "perl", "cgi": "perl",
"js": "javascript", "js": "javascript",
@ -2274,6 +2273,8 @@ function havePermission() {
} }
return bool; return bool;
} }
// global module workaround
window.havePermission = havePermission;
//socket.io actions //socket.io actions
var socket = io.connect({ var socket = io.connect({